I am trying to redirect all my msn mail to a personal folder on Outlook (i
have several email accounts within Outlook and prefer to consolidate them).
I am using Outlook Connector. I have tried setting “Deliver new email to the
following location†to Personal Folder, somehow that doesn’t work, the mail
stays in my msn tree structure folders.

I have also tried to outsmart this by adding a rule that says for incoming
(and a similar rule for sent/ outgoing messages): Apply this rule after
message arrives, move it to Personal Folder. Somehow that does not work
either. I also tried “Apply this rule after message arrives through
(e-mail address removed) (i.e., the specified account), move it to
Personal Folder. Neither did that work.

The rules do sometimes work if I specifically hit “run ruleâ€, but they never
run automatically.

Any advice on how to get the rules to run right? Or is there another way
entirely (besides killing my msn mail account!).

Many thanks.
 
Outlook doesn't support running rules automatically on msn accounts. It also
won't deliver msn mail to a personal folder because it's a server account.

Either continue to run rules manually or just drag and drop the messages to
the personal folder.
